Abstract

The present invention relates to a kind of high transmittance liquid-crystal composition and its application.The liquid-crystal composition includes the compound representated by formula I formulas V.Wherein, formula I and general formula II are as follows.Liquid-crystal composition provided by the present invention significantly reduces the ε of liquid-crystal composition(ratio of parallel dielectric and vertical dielectric), serve the effect of good lifting transmitance.Exactly liquid-crystal composition provided by the present invention has big vertical dielectric, and then has high transmitance.

Technical field
The present invention relates to a kind of liquid-crystal composition, specifically a kind of nematic phase liquid crystal composition, belong to liquid crystal material And its application field.
Background technology
At present, LCD product technologies are ripe, successfully solve the technologies such as visual angle, resolution ratio, color saturation and brightness Problem, its display performance is already close to or more than CRT monitor.Large scale and small-medium size LCD are gradual in respective field Occupy the dominant position of flat-panel monitor.Liquid crystal belongs to passive luminescence display, that is to say, that what liquid crystal panel played is photoswitch Effect, light by transmitance after liquid crystal panel be 6% or so, in order to lift brightness, it is necessary to strengthen backlight illumination, Jin Erxu More electric energy are consumed to be used to lift backlight illumination.This greatly improves the cost of backlight.So lifting liquid crystal panel is saturating Crossing rate turns into the difficult point of current liquid crystal display.
Specifically, for IPS (being changed in face) and FFS (fringing field effect) mode display, liquid-crystal composition is reduced ε(ratio of parallel dielectric and vertical dielectric) can effectively lift the transmitance of liquid crystal display.
The content of the invention
Liquid-crystal composition provided by the present invention significantly reduces the ε of liquid-crystal composition(parallel dielectric with it is vertical The ratio of dielectric), serve the good effect for lifting transmitance.Exactly liquid-crystal composition provided by the present invention has big Vertical dielectric, and then there is high transmitance.

Liquid-crystal composition provided by the present invention increases the vertical dielectric of liquid-crystal composition by adding class ii compound, Dielectric anisotropic is lifted by compound I, and then obtains the liquid-crystal composition with big vertical dielectric, lifts liquid crystal Show device transmitance.By the optimum organization of each component, and then obtain the liquid-crystal composition of high transmittance with fast-response.
Liquid-crystal composition of the present invention has big vertical dielectric constant, and then is situated between with low parallel dielectric with vertical The ratio of electric constant.
The preparation method of liquid-crystal composition of the present invention can be changed two or more using conventional method without specifically limited Compound mixing is produced, such as by mixing different component and method soluble in one another preparation at high temperature, wherein, by liquid crystal group Compound is dissolved in the solvent for the compound and mixed, and then distills out the solvent under reduced pressure;It is or of the present invention Liquid-crystal composition can be prepared conventionally, and the wherein less component of content is such as dissolved in into content at a higher temperature In larger key component, or each affiliated component dissolved in organic solvent, such as acetone, chloroform or methanol then will be molten Liquid mixing obtains after removing solvent.
The present invention also provides application of the above-mentioned liquid-crystal composition in IPS or FFS mode display.It is in IPS or FFS moulds Use in formula display can be obviously improved the transmitance of liquid crystal display, effectively improve display effect and reduce energy consumption.

Compared with embodiment 1 is collected with each performance parameter value of the gained liquid-crystal composition of comparative example 1, referring to table 14.
Table 14:The performance parameter of liquid-crystal composition compares
Δn ε∥ ε⊥ Δε Cp ε∥/ε⊥
Embodiment 1 0.103 5.9 3.4 +2.5 80 1.735
Comparative example 1 0.097 5.1 2.6 +2.5 78 1.962
Through relatively understanding:Compared with comparative example 1, the liquid-crystal composition that embodiment 1 provides has low parallel dielectric with hanging down The ratio of straight dielectric, so with higher transmitance.Equally, empirical tests, the liquid-crystal composition that embodiment 2-11 is provided are put down The ratio of row dielectric and vertical dielectric is also below comparative example 1.
Transmitance is carried out to embodiment 1 and comparative example 1 to simulate to obtain data below table 15:
The embodiment 1 of table 15. is compared with the transmitance of comparative example 1
Embodiment 1 Comparative example 1
Transmitance % 0.28672 0.27165
Embodiment 1 lifts 5.5% or so relative to the transmitance of comparative example 1.Its simulation curve is as shown in Figure 1.Pass through simultaneously Checking, the transmitance for the liquid-crystal composition that embodiment 2-11 is provided are lifted between 3-6% compared to the transmitance of comparative example 1.
As seen from the above embodiment, liquid-crystal composition provided by the present invention has big vertical dielectric, and then with more Low parallel dielectric and the ratio of vertical dielectric, further there is higher transmitance.Therefore, liquid crystal group provided by the present invention IPS the or FFS type TFT liquid crystal display devices that compound is applied to, the transmitance of liquid crystal display can be obviously improved, reduce backlight The energy loss in source, especially suitable for fast-response FFS type TV liquid crystal displays.
